In 1912, Wesley Richards entered the world in Abbeville, Henry, Alabama, USA, born to Joseph Richards And Minnie Lee. In 1920, Wesley Richards resided in Centerville, Henry, Alabama, USA. In 1930, Wesley Richards resided in Centerville, Henry, Alabama, USA. Wesley Richards married Sallie Pearl Wheeler, and had children including Bobby Lee Richards, Constance Richards, Freddie L Richards, Margaret Louise Richards, Mary Pearl Richards, Mildred Richards, Robert Glenn Richards Sr, Wheeler Lee Richards. Wesley Richards passed away in 1981 in Abbeville, Henry, Alabama, USA.
